## set_field: Rust derive macro for structs | ||
|
||
Set fields on structs by string. | ||
|
||
# SetField trait | ||
```rust | ||
pub trait SetField<T> { | ||
fn set_field(&mut self, field: &str, value: T) -> bool; |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
# Example | ||
|
||
```rust | ||
use set_field::SetField; | ||
|
||
#[derive(SetField)] | ||
struct Foo { | ||
a: i32, | ||
b: Option<bool>, | ||
c: i32, | ||
} | ||
fn test() { | ||
let mut t = Foo { a: 777, b: None, c: 0 }; | ||
// return true on success: | ||
assert_eq!(t.set_field("a", 888), true); | ||
// return true on success: | ||
assert_eq!(t.set_field("b", Some(true)), true); | ||
assert_eq!(t.a, 888); | ||
assert_eq!(t.b, Some(true)); | ||
// return false on nonexistent field: | ||
assert_eq!(t.set_field("d", 0), false); | ||
// return false on wrong type: | ||
assert_eq!(t.set_field("b", 0), false); | ||
// won't compile: | ||
// assert_eq!(t.set_field("a", 0.0), false); |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
* set_field returns true on success. | ||
* set_field returns false if field doesn't exist. | ||
* set_field returns false if you attempt to set a field to the wrong type. | ||
|
||
# Expanded Foo struct from above | ||
|
||
The SetField macro expands Foo into this: | ||
|
||
```rust | ||
struct Foo { | ||
a: i32, | ||
b: Option<bool>, | ||
c: i32, | ||
} | ||
impl SetField<i32> for Foo { | ||
fn set_field(&mut self, field: &str, value: i32) -> bool { | ||
match field { | ||
"a" => { | ||
self.a = value; | ||
true | ||
} | ||
"c" => { | ||
self.c = value; | ||
true | ||
} | ||
_ => false, |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
impl SetField<Option<bool>> for Foo { | ||
fn set_field(&mut self, field: &str, value: Option<bool>) -> bool { | ||
match field { | ||
"b" => { | ||
self.b = value; | ||
true | ||
} | ||
_ => false, |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
# Dependencies | ||
|
||
[syn](https://crates.io/crates/syn) and [quote](https://crates.io/crates/quote) |

//! derive macro for set_field | ||
use proc_macro::TokenStream; | ||
use quote::quote; | ||
use std::collections::BTreeMap; | ||
use syn::{Data, DeriveInput, Fields, Ident, Type}; | ||
|
||
#[proc_macro_derive(SetField)] | ||
/// # Example | ||
/// ``` | ||
/// use set_field::SetField; | ||
/// #[derive(SetField)] | ||
/// struct Foo { a: i32 } | ||
/// fn test() { | ||
/// let mut foo = Foo { a: 777 }; | ||
/// foo.set_field("a", 888); | ||
/// } | ||
// ``` | ||
pub fn set_field_derive(input: TokenStream) -> TokenStream { | ||
let ast = syn::parse(input).unwrap(); | ||
impl_set_field(&ast) | ||
} | ||
|
||
fn impl_set_field(ast: &DeriveInput) -> TokenStream { | ||
let name = &ast.ident; | ||
// indirect BTreeMap<syn::Type, Vec<Ident>> | ||
let mut type_map: BTreeMap<usize, Vec<Ident>> = BTreeMap::new(); | ||
let mut types: Vec<Type> = vec![]; | ||
match &ast.data { | ||
Data::Struct(ref data) => match &data.fields { | ||
Fields::Named(fields) => { | ||
for f in &fields.named { | ||
match &f.ident { | ||
Some(i) => { | ||
if !types.contains(&f.ty) { | ||
types.push(f.ty.to_owned()); | ||
} | ||
let index = types.iter().position(|x| x == &f.ty).unwrap(); | ||
match type_map.get_mut(&index) { | ||
Some(v) => { | ||
v.push(i.clone()); | ||
} | ||
None => { | ||
type_map.insert(index, vec![i.clone()]);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
None => {}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
_ => {} | ||
}, | ||
_ => { | ||
panic!("struct only!"); | ||
} | ||
}; | ||
let mut impls = quote!(); | ||
let mut matches; | ||
for x in type_map { | ||
matches = quote!(); | ||
let ty = &types[x.0]; | ||
for id in x.1 { | ||
let s = id.to_string(); | ||
matches.extend(quote! { | ||
#s => { | ||
self.#id = value; | ||
true |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
} | ||
impls.extend(quote! { | ||
impl SetField<#ty> for #name { | ||
fn set_field(&mut self, field: &str, value: #ty) -> bool { | ||
match field { | ||
#matches | ||
_ => { false } |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
} | ||
impls.into() | ||
} |
